OR %LocalAppData%\VirtualStore\Program Files (x86)\LucasArts\SWKotORII Your saves for KOTOR 2, if you're not playing via Steam, will be in the saves and cloudsaves folders, which can be found at one of the following paths: %LocalAppData%\VirtualStore\Program Files\LucasArts\SWKotORII Steamapps > common > Knights of the Old Republic II > saves OR cloudsaves Non-Steam If the above paths don't exist, use this guide to find out where your KOTOR 2 installation is, then proceed through the following folders: OR C:\Program Files\Steam\steamapps\common\Knights of the Old Republic II If you're playing KOTOR 2 on Steam, you can find your game save files in either the saves or cloudsaves folder at one of the following locations: C:\Program Files (x86)\Steam\steamapps\common\Knights of the Old Republic II See help for your specific installation below. The location of your game saves in KOTOR 2 depends on how you've installed the game. The game has received a review rating of 8.5/10 on Gamespot with players speaking highly of its story line and new features however some users have commented on its long load time and a few minor glitches. They are on a mission to find who exiled them and then search for the other remaining Jedi, to help them in a battle to destroy the Sith. Players assume control of the Jedi Knight who, 10 years ago, was banished from the Order.
KOTOR 2 is the second in the series following Star Wars: Knights of the Old Republic and is an action role-playing video game that can be played cross -platform. Run on Bioware, KOTOR 2 was Published by LucasArts, which is well known for its association with the Star Wars and Indiana Jones games.
Star Wars Knights of the Old Republic II (KOTOR 2) was first released on 6th December 2004 and is available to play on Xbox, Microsoft Windows, Macintosh operating systems and Linux.
